安全云环境中基于minhash函数的多关键字检索方案

摘    要:为了降低硬件购置成本,许多机构倾向于使用稳健快速的云服务将他们的数据转包出去;然而,外包数据可能含有需要防护的敏感数据;而云提供商并不能可靠满足这一要求.因此,必须采取防护措施,以保护敏感数据不受到云服务器和其他未授权机构的破坏.提出了一种基于Minhash函数的高效加密云数据隐私保护多关键字检索方法;该方法根据数据所有者生成并外包给云服务器的加密可检索索引进行加密云检索.已知检索内容后,服务器采用tf-idf加权法将检索内容与可检索索引相比较,除了鉴于隐私因素可被泄露的信息外,不需其他信息即可返回结果.基于公开的Enron数据集的仿真实验结果表明,该方法可保证用户只会检索到最相关的条目,不会对用户造成不必要的通信和计算负担.另外,在检索精度方面,也要优于现有的方法.

Multi-Keyword Search Scheme Based on minhash Function in Secure Cloud Environment

Abstract:In order to reduce the purchase cost of hardware, many organizations tend to outsource their data utilizing robust and fast services of clouds. Nevertheless, the outsourced data may contain sensitive information that needs to be hidden. With which the cloud providers are not necessarily trusted. Therefore, some precautions are required to protect the sensitive data from both the cloud server and any other non-authorized party. In this paper, we propose an efficient privacy-preserving and multi-keyword search method over encrypted cloud data that utilizes minhash functions. Search over encrypted cloud is performed through an encrypted searchable index that is generated by the data owner and outsourced to a cloud server. Given a query, by the weighted method of , server compares the query with the searchable index and returns the results without learning anything other than the information that is allowed to be leaked due to efficiency concerns. The simulation results based on the open Enron data sets show that, this approach ensures that only the most relevant items are retrieved by the user, preventing unnecessary communication and computation burden on the user. In addition, , the proposed method is better than the existing method in terms of the retrieval accuracy.
